From 127989fcc3cd6acdf5a0db1195c7ec2826654fec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Niels=20M=C3=B6ller?= <nisse@lysator.liu.se>
Date: Sat, 15 Mar 1997 04:56:51 +0100
Subject: [PATCH] Handle submodules

Rev: lib/modules/Crypto.pmod.pike:1.3
---
 lib/modules/Crypto.pmod.pike |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/lib/modules/Crypto.pmod.pike b/lib/modules/Crypto.pmod.pike
index 3d617681af..ffbc7701e4 100644
--- a/lib/modules/Crypto.pmod.pike
+++ b/lib/modules/Crypto.pmod.pike
@@ -7,6 +7,8 @@
 mixed `[](string name)
 {
 //  return (::`[](name) || ((program) ("Crypto/" + name)));
-    return (_Crypto[name] || ((program) ("Crypto/" + name)));
+    return (_Crypto[name]
+	    || ((program) ("Crypto/" + name))
+	    || ((object) ("Crypto/" + name + ".pmod")));
 }
 
-- 
GitLab